Georgia weather in November, city by city
Real November averages from 10 years of climate data (2015–2024). Note how much the cities differ — this is why "Georgia weather" alone is misleading.
| City | Avg high | Avg low | Rainy days | Verdict |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Tbilisi | 11.4°C | 3.4°C | 7 | Cool — bring layers |
| Batumi | 16.5°C | 8.4°C | 13 | Wet season — plan around rain |
| Kutaisi | 15.5°C | 7.7°C | 12 | Wet season — plan around rain |
| Kazbegi (Stepantsminda) | 4.9°C | -4.1°C | 9 | Cold — pack heavy |
| Mtskheta | 12.7°C | 4°C | 7 | Cool — bring layers |
| Mestia | 6.4°C | -2.8°C | 12 | Wet season — plan around rain |
| Borjomi | 10.5°C | 0.9°C | 11 | Cool — bring layers |
| Sighnaghi | 11°C | 3.4°C | 7 | Cool — bring layers |
What to pack for Georgia in November
With highs around 11.4°C and lows near -4.1°C, pack warm layers, a proper jacket, and closed shoes, a warm fleece or down layer for cold nights, a compact umbrella or rain shell.

Public holidays in Georgia, November
- 2026-11-23 — Saint George's Day
- 2027-11-23 — Saint George's Day
Major sites can be crowded or closed around these dates — plan your itinerary accordingly.
